The West Virginia Legislature gaveled into session on Wednesday, and Senate Bill 30, a bill to legalize on-site Power Purchase Agreements (PPAs), was introduced on opening day. Let your legislators know that you support SB 30 and want them to legalize on-site PPAs in 2021!

PPAs are a critical financing mechanism that can help businesses, homeowners, and civic institutions like schools, governments, and churches save money on their electricity costs. But West Virginia’s monopoly utility companies would prefer to protect their profit margins by blocking this legislation.
